Career Path

The Certified Professional in Refugee Rights and Security Studies pursues various rewarding **career paths** in the United Kingdom. This section highlights the **job market trends** represented through a 3D pie chart, displaying the percentage distribution of different roles related to this field. As a **legal officer**, you would provide counsel to refugees and asylum seekers, ensuring their rights are protected and upheld according to the law. This role requires strong communication skills and a deep understanding of international and national laws. A **policy analyst** in this field would research and evaluate existing policies, recommending improvements to enhance the lives of refugees and asylum seekers. This role demands strong analytical skills and a keen understanding of policy-making processes. **Resettlement officers** work directly with refugees, providing essential services and support during their resettlement process. This role necessitates empathy, cultural sensitivity, and a commitment to serving vulnerable populations. As an **advocacy coordinator**, you would lead campaigns and initiatives to raise awareness of refugee rights and security issues. This role requires excellent public speaking and networking skills, as well as a deep passion for social justice. Finally, **programme managers** oversee projects and initiatives related to refugee rights and security studies, ensuring their successful implementation and monitoring outcomes. This role involves strong leadership and organizational skills, as well as the ability to work well under pressure.
